Overview

Execution

JurassicWorld.com was designed to be mobile-first and responsive for old fans and new. Filled with thoughtful details, the site builds anticipation by showcasing everything the real Jurassic World would offer: hotels, attractions, time-reactive announcements, video feeds, and of course, dinosaurs. At the center of it all, an interactive map encourages users to explore Isla Nublar, location by location.

We also created a more traditional Jurassic World EPK site, where fans could discover more about the cast, crew and storyline, as well as watch the Jurassic World trailers -- which were also created in-house.

Outcome

The site has kept fans coming back with over 1.7 million visitors in the first 4 months. Visitors have been digging into the code to discover easter eggs, and every minor update generating a flurry of social media conversation and increased excitement for this summer's most anticipated blockbuster.

New sections will continue to launch prior to the film’s release, driving traffic and interest in the movie. Additionally, the site’s RaptorPass allows fans to receive exclusive content and gathers fan emails for future outreach.
